3. Environmental Checklist <br /> <br />San Leandro Treatment Wetland <br />IS/MND <br />3-5 February 2024 <br /> <br />3.3. Agriculture and Forestry Resources <br />ISSUES: AGRICULTURE AND FORESTRY RESOURCES <br />POTENTIALLY <br />SIGNIFICANT <br />IMPACT <br />LESS THAN <br />SIGNIFICANT <br />WITH <br />MITIGATION <br />INCORPORATED <br />LESS THAN <br />SIGNIFICANT <br />IMPACT <br />NO IMPACT <br />Would the Project: <br />a) Convert Prime Farmland, Unique Farmland, or <br />Farmland of Statewide Importance (Farmland), as <br />shown on the maps prepared pursuant to the <br />Farmland Mapping and Monitoring Program of the <br />California Resources Agency, to non-agricultural <br />use? <br />☐ ☐ ☐ ☒ <br />b) Conflict with existing zoning for agricultural use, <br />or a Williamson Act contract? ☐ ☐ ☐ ☒ <br />c) Conflict with existing zoning for, or cause <br />rezoning of, forest land (as defined in Public <br />Resources Code Section 12220(g)), timberland (as <br />defined by Public Resources Code Section 4526), or <br />timberland zoned Timberland Production (as defined <br />by Government Code Section 51104(g))? <br />☐ ☐ ☐ ☒ <br />d) Result in the loss of forest land or conversion of <br />forest land to non-forest use? ☐ ☐ ☐ ☒ <br />e) Involve other changes in the existing <br />environment which, due to their location or nature, <br />could result in conversion of Farmland, to non- <br />agricultural use or conversion of forest land to non- <br />forest use? <br />☐ ☐ ☐ ☒ <br />Discussion <br />a-e) Conflicts with agricultural or forestry resources. The Project site is classified as Public/Institutional in <br />the San Leandro General Plan and is zoned as Industrial General.10,11 Since the land within the <br />Project site is neither used for agricultural nor forest land production, and there is no zoning <br />designated for agricultural/forest use or a Williamson Act contract in place, implementing the Project <br />will not affect agricultural and forest resources. <br />Impact Designation: No Impact <br />Cumulative Impacts on Agriculture and Forestry Resources <br />The potential for cumulative impacts on agriculture and forestry resources encompasses the sub-region <br />encompassing the WPCP and its adjacent regions.
